Record your daily spending every month. This way you can see all the money going out.
Don’t worry about changing your spending habits straight away. Just track day by day.
It might be easier to track with your partner or a friend: you can encourage each other and stay on track.
How to track your spending
1.Use a phone app.
A phone app is an easy way to track your spending at the time you spend.
Some apps offer more options, such as setting spending limits and reminders, and seeing your expenses at a glance.
2. Look at your statements and receipts.
When you use a debit or credit card, every transaction is recorded for you.
You can view or download these transactions using online banking, or look at your hard-copy statements or receipts.
3. Write it down.
Write down every Naira you spend. Include the amount, item (or store name) and date. You should do this for both cash and card purchases.
Do this as you spend, or set a reminder to do it once a day, using your receipts.
4. Avoid cash.
Use your ATM or online banking apps to make payment. It's easier to track expenses that way.
